Transaction 2302759aacb21333149618a059ae547e10f12d4816662d13a6f27cb330444208
1 Input
1 Output
-
2302759aacb21333149618a059ae547e10f12d4816662d13a6f27cb330444208:0
- value
- 258278786
- script pubkey
- OP_0 OP_PUSHBYTES_20 aa381bf63d4773200211498f68a835cc96e122d5
- address
- bc1q4gupha3agaejqqs3fx8k32p4ejtwzgk4fe39vt